Liver pudding - The biggest difference between livermush and scrapple comes down to their ingredients. Livermush, as the name describes, contains liver and other pork scraps, while scrapple is made using any available pork scraps and does not always contain liver. Telangiectasis ('plum-pudding liver') is a condition of the liver affecting cattle, sheep, poultry and horses. The lesions are characterised by focal dilatation and congestion of the hepatic sinusoids. All animals may be affected by the lesions but they are more commonly seen in older animals. By John Martin Taylor. Published 1992. About. Recipes. Contents. Not every Lowcountry butcher makes liver pudding; even fewer home cooks do. The tradition seems strongest about 70 miles inland, where German and Swiss immigrants settled in the early 18th century. Alcoholic liver disease is damage to the liver and its function due to alcohol abuse. Alcoholi...Livermush is a well-made, well-seasoned, liver-rich spread, just like many patés and terrines. Livermush is a puree of pig's liver and spices bound with enough cooked cornmeal mush to make it moldable and sliceable. Livermush, also known as liver pudding, is a traditional Southern dish that has its roots deeply embedded in the culinary history of the Appalachian region. It is a type of sausage-like loaf made primarily from a mixture of ground pork liver, cornmeal, and spices.
